Announcing Copper group practices starting NEXT WEEK!
If you have kids who are just shy of making the Bronze team, then Copper is here for you!
- Available to register now on myshepherdwellness.com.
- Mondays and Wednesdays 5-6 pm.
The Copper Pre-Team program works through the Red Cross Learn to Swim Levels 4-5 with an emphasis on swim team readiness. This program functions as an introduction to swim team and also serves as competitive team evaluations/tryouts.
- Requirements: Safely jump into deep water and swim back to the wall, and can handle themselves safely in a group learning environment.
